Rahul travels in Shatabdi chair car to Ludhiana

Last Updated 15 September 2009, 05:47 IST

A day after his mother flew to Mumbai in the economy class, Rahul boarded the train this morning from the New Delhi Railway Station to travel to the northern industrial city.

Rahul refused to accept flowers presented to him at the station, saying it was the privilege of the executive class passengers and also demanded that he be served water in a plastic cup like other passengers.

Passengers travelling by the train were elated to know that the young leader was travelling with them.

"It is good that Rahul Gandhi is travelling with common people. He will get to see our problems first hand," a male passenger said.

A woman travelling in the same coach said, "I am feeling great after hearing that I will travel with Rahul Gandhi".

Railway officials said that Rahul will be served 'parathas,' curd, 'idli,' 'vada' and fruits.
However, this menu was exclusively for him, the officials said, adding that any specific requests by Rahul will be gladly met.

Rahul is going to the city to inaugurate a four-day camp of young Congressmen.
The AICC general secretary will return to the national capital by the same train in the evening.

Congress chief Sonia Gandhi, who was behind the decision to ask two ministers S M Krishna and Shashi Tharoor to move to modest accommodation from their five-star dwelling afer a media expose, yesterday flew to Mumbai in a commercial flight in an ordinary class seat to participate in a party function in the financial hub.
